Bhubaneswar: The garden of Lok Seva Bhawan in Bhubaneswar will remain open to public on all government holidays including Sundays in January.
According to a release from the Chief Minister’s Office (CMO) on Saturday, the people can visit the garden in the Lok Seva Bhawan starting from Sunday.
They can use the opportunity to visit the garden of the state secretariat to enjoy lush green lawns and varieties of colourful and attractive flowers of exotic varieties that have been grown on the premises.
The garden will remain open for the public visit from 3.30 pm to 5.30 pm on Sundays, the release stated.
